JONSBO Unveils X400 PRO White Mid-Tower PC Case with Aluminum Frame

JONSBO has announced the X400 PRO White, a new mid-tower PC case designed for enthusiasts. The manufacturer revealed the product on May 18, 2026. This release adds a white colorway to the company's existing lineup of chassis options.

New mid-tower chassis features robust aluminum frame and dual-chamber cooling design

The chassis features a robust aluminum frame construction. It includes tempered glass panels on the front and left side for visibility. The internal layout utilizes a dual-chamber design to separate heat-generating components. A dedicated cable cover sits behind the motherboard tray to manage wiring.

The case supports ATX, MicroATX, and Mini-ITX motherboards. It measures 310.9mm in width, 460.7mm in depth, and 476.8mm in height. The unit weighs 11.3kg. It accommodates graphics cards up to 427mm long. Users can install CPU coolers up to 176mm in height. The power supply bay supports units up to 180mm deep.

Cooling flexibility is a key feature of the X400 PRO White. The top panel supports either three 120mm fans or two 140mm fans. It also accepts 280mm or 360mm radiators. The side panel allows for three 120mm fans or a single 360mm radiator. Additional mounting points exist for two 120mm fans on the rear, three on the bottom, and two on the motherboard tray. The case provides seven expansion slots and includes drive bays for one 2.5-inch and two 3.5-inch drives.

JONSBO has not disclosed pricing or availability details for the X400 PRO White. The company has not confirmed a specific launch window for the product. Buyers will need to wait for further announcements regarding retail distribution.
